WebSep 12, 2024 · Travelling at roughly 8,700 mph across our sky, GPS satellites move fast enough for Einstein's theory of special relativity to have a noticeable effect on their clocks, slowing them by 7 microseconds each day. WebDec 22, 2024 · With precise timing from the satellite's atomic clocks incorporated into the GPS signal, GPS receivers are able to access that precision by decoding the signal and resetting their clocks (often less accurate quartz oscillators) to sync with the atomic clocks. The receivers use their internal clocks to detect the time delay and determine distance.
